The unique, proprietary data that your business uses on a daily basis can be an extremely valuable marketing tool.

By analyzing the data your company has collected, you can uncover trends in industry developments and customer feedback. Repurposing this information into useful content for your consumers and industry peers will appeal to a wider audience and expand the reach of your message.

For example, The Audit Group, Inc. (TAG), a leading supply chain and accounts payable consulting company for complex healthcare systems nationwide, is able to transform its collected data into actionable insights. TAG incorporates these insights into its marketing strategy by packaging the findings as actionable advice and sharing with its contact database through a regular email newsletter.

Where the Data Comes From
Important industry information, such as best practices or trends can be gathered from customers, regular business operations or the knowledge of experienced employees. Regardless of the source, it is vital to document this data for potential use in the future.

How to Harness the Data
Data that is relevant to your industry can be used in a variety of ways to appeal to a large audience while boosting your reputation as a thought leader among important demographics. This can be accomplished through direct newsletters, contributed articles in trade publications, internal blog posts on your company website or even brief social media posts.

Repurposing industry data through a variety of channels ensures that your business is making use of every available opportunity to stand out from the competition.
